Justice Robert C. Bollinger is seeking two Appellate Court Law Clerks for his chambers in Decatur, Illinois. The Appellate Court Law Clerk performs legal research, analysis, and writing, and reviews and assists in the drafting of judicial opinions, orders, and other legal documents.

DUTIES INCLUDE:

  • Conduct legal research and prepare memoranda of law providing legal and procedural advice on a variety of issues before the Court.
  • Assist in drafting opinions, orders, and other memoranda.
  • Edit and cite check final draft orders, opinions, dissents, or special concurrences.
  • Advise the Justice on research of court rules and points of law on pending legal cases.
  • Research law regarding issues addressed by parties or the court.
  • Assist the Justice in preparation for an educational conference or speaking engagements.
  • Study current legal publications, recent opinions of the Illinois Supreme and Appellate Courts, and other relevant state and federal cases; stay apprised of recent legislation.
  • Assist the Justice in his committee work.
  • May supervise the work of law school externs.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.

KNOWLEDGE AND SKILLS:

  • Working knowledge of, and ability to apply, federal and state laws and court decisions to pending legal cases.
  • Working knowledge of, and ability to apply, court procedures and rules of evidence.
  • Skill in providing legal research and preparing memorandum of law providing legal and procedural advice.
  • Skill in analyzing legal issues and writing persuasively.
  • Skill in applying legal principles and specialized knowledge to individual cases and problems.
  • Ability to communicate effectively.
  • Ability to apprise the Justice of new statutes and recent legislation changes.
  • Ability to work with the Court, colleagues, and the public in a pleasant, courteous, and helpful manner.
  • Ability to comport oneself in a manner which is cognizant of the Court’s ethical responsibilities.

E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E: Applicants must be a licensed attorney and admitted to the Illinois bar, as well as possess excellent research, case analysis, and writing skills. Experience as a law clerk in a reviewing court is strongly preferred.
